The Met Gala, formally called the Costume Institute Gala and also known as the Met Ball, is an annual fundraising gala for the benefit of the Metropolitan Museum of Art's Costume Institute in New York City. It marks the grand opening of the Costume Institute's annual fashion exhibit.
The theme this year was: China: Through The Looking Glass

New York, NY, May 4th 2015 – Rita Ora perfectly showcased an Asian influence style at the China themed Met Ball with a flawless makeup look created by all celebrity makeup artist, Kathy Jeung using Rimmel London. Rita wore a stunning Tom Ford red silk cheongsam inspired dress. Kathy wanted to focus on a red lip to match the color of the dress with a hint of red eyeliner and a wash of pink blush.
To get this look Kathy applied Rimmel London Lasting Finish 25HR Foundation with Comfort Serum, with a brush then further blended it with a makeup sponge dampened with water. Then Kathy brushed Rimmel London Lasting Finish Blush in Tickle Me Pink on Rita’s cheeks for a pop of color.
For Rita’s eyes, Kathy drew a thin line along Rita’s upper lash line with Rimmel London Precision Micro Eyeliner in Black, extending outwards for a wing shape. Over the outer part of the top liner, Kathy used Rimmel London Exaggerate Automatic Lip Liner in Red Diva and smudged it slightly. Kathy finished Rita’s eyes with Rimmel London Wonder’lash Mascara with Argan Oil in Waterproof to volumize her lashes and enhance the wing shape.
To complete this look, Kathy used Rimmel London Exaggerate Automatic Lip Liner in Red Diva to define Rita’s mouth shape then applied Rimmel London Show Off Lip Velvet Matte in Burning Lava.
